South Seaville has a relatively moderate overall natural hazard risk rating according to FEMA's National Risk Index. The top hazard risks are coastal flood, strong wind, hurricane. The area has had 34 federal disaster declarations. The most common disaster type is hurricane (10 declarations). 28,013 flood insurance claims have been filed in the area. FEMA has obligated $56,391,054 in public assistance recovery funding.
